Man falls 350 feet off Grand Canyon rim, dies

Posted at 10:49 AM, Mar 18, 2014
and last updated 2014-03-18 10:49:05-04

(CNN) — A Texas man died after falling off the south rim of the Grand Canyon, officials at the national park said Monday.

John N. Anderson of Grapevine, Texas, was visiting the park with family on Saturday morning when he fell about 350 feet near the El Tovar Lodge.

Park rangers found Anderson but were unable to resuscitate him.

The National Park Service and the Coconino County, Arizona, medical examiner are investigating the incident.
